Can candidates deliver on jobs?
Pennsylvania was third in the nation for job growth in 2025, according to data from the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ics. While nearly one-third of states saw a year of losses in 2025, from December 2024 to December 2025, Pennsylvania gained more than 76,000 jobs — a 1.2 percent increase year-over-year, compared to a 0.4 percent increase nationally. That’s great news if you live near one of the state’s urban areas, but doesn’t mean much in a lot of rural counties.
